FLYING DOCTOR'S TRIP
JOURNEY BY NIGHT
RETURN - WITH PATIENT (Reed. March 7, 2.20 p.m.) DARWIN, March 7. Dr. Fenton, the Northern Territory flying doctor, reached Darwin to-day after a dramatic emergency flight. In order to bring in a sick young man he flew GOO miles, including nearly 300 by night, without radio or anything but crude ground facilities.
